Executive Committee Positions
The PTSA President helps lead the board, supports committee chairs, works closely with school administration, and helps keep the PTSA organized and moving forward throughout the year. This role includes helping plan meetings, communicating with board members, supporting PTSA programs, and making sure our goals align with the needs of Lyman students, families, teachers, and staff. This position is nominated by general membership at the end of the school year at the last General Meeting so the incoming board can begin working over the summer.

The Vice President supports the President and helps where needed throughout the year. This position may assist with board communication, committee support, event planning, membership goals, and stepping in when the President is unavailable. This is a great role for someone who wants to be involved in leadership and help keep the PTSA running smoothly.This position is nominated by general membership at the end of the school year at the last General Meeting so the incoming board can begin working over the summer.

The Treasurer helps manage PTSA funds, tracks income and expenses, prepares financial reports, supports budgeting, and helps ensure all funds are handled responsibly. This position is important for keeping our PTSA transparent, organized, and financially prepared to support students, staff, programs, scholarships, and school needs. This position is nominated by general membership at the end of the school year at the last General Meeting so the incoming board can begin working over the summer.

The Recording Secretary keeps accurate minutes at PTSA meetings and helps maintain official records. This role is perfect for someone who is organ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able taking notes during meetings so that board decisions, motions, and important updates are properly documented. This position is nominated by general membership at the end of the school year at the last General Meeting so the incoming board can begin working over the summer.

The Corresponding Secretary helps with PTSA communication, including emails, thank-you notes, announcements, and other correspondence as needed. This position helps keep communication clear and professional between the PTSA, families, staff, community partners, and board members. This position is nominated by general membership at the end of the school year at the last General Meeting so the incoming board can begin working over the summer.

Committee Chair Positions
The Programs Chair helps plan and support PTSA programs and events that benefit students, families, and the school community. This role may include helping organize educational programs, student activities, family engagement opportunities, guest speakers, or other events that align with PTSA goals.

The Ways & Means Chair helps plan and support fundraising opportunities for the PTSA. This may include restaurant nights, spirit nights, donation campaigns, sponsorship opportunities, school store fundraising, and other creative ways to raise funds that help support students, staff, scholarships, programs, and school needs.

The Scholarship Chair helps organize the PTSA scholarship process for graduating seniors. This may include helping review scholarship guidelines, organizing applications, coordinating with 2 reviewers, communicating deadlines, and helping celebrate scholarship recipients. This position plays an important role in helping PTSA support students as they take their next step after graduation.

The Reflections Chair helps organize Lyman PTSA’s participation in the National PTA Reflections arts program. This role includes sharing program information, collecting student entries, communicating deadlines, and helping celebrate students who participate in visual arts, photography, literature, music, dance, film, and other creative categories.
